China's Pan Zhanle joins David Popovici for training camp in Romania

Image

Olympic swimming champion David Popovici announced on Monday on his Facebook page that he will train in Romania alongside Pan Zhanle, one of the world's top swimmers and the holder of the 100-metre freestyle world record.

Popovici is convinced the training camp will provide an important exchange of experience for both athletes.

'I am happy to welcome my friend Pan Zhanle and his team to Romania for a joint training camp. I am convinced this collaboration will be a valuable exchange of experience for all of us, both athletically and culturally. I am still practising how to say 'Welcome!' correctly in Mandarin: 'huan-ying'. To allow us to fully focus on training, we respectfully ask you - journalists and fans - to support us by respecting the strictly professional nature of the programme throughout the camp. Thank you for your understanding, and we count on your support!,' Popovici wrote on social media.

Aged 21, Pan Zhanle is one of Popovici's most formidable rivals. The Chinese swimmer, a double Olympic champion, holds the world record in the 100 m freestyle - 46.40 seconds, set at the Paris Olympic Games - a record previously held by Popovici.
